The Sri Lanka Economic & Investment Summit 2025, themed “Gateway to Growth: Asia’s Emerging Opportunity”, will be held on 2–3 December at the Shangri-La Colombo. A key sector deep dive on Day One will examine how Sri Lanka can broaden its export base and deliver sustained growth through diversification.

The session, “The New Age of Diversified Exports – Delivering on Diversified Export Products and Markets”, will highlight the urgency of moving beyond traditional export sectors as global demand patterns shift and resilience becomes a strategic imperative. The discussion will explore untapped opportunities in high-value industries such as cinnamon, seafood, electronics, minerals, and advanced manufacturing. It will also examine how Sri Lanka can strengthen its position in non-traditional markets through branding, standards, logistics, and strategic trade partnerships.

The keynote address will be delivered by Prof. Sanjay Kathuria, Visiting Senior Fellow at the Centre for Social and Economic Progress. Prof. Kathuria holds a Doctorate in Economics from the University of Oxford, and has over 27 years of experience at the World Bank, and a decade at ICRIER in New Delhi. He is also the co-founder of the Trade Sentinel, and a Non-Resident Senior Fellow at the Institute of South Asian Studies in Singapore.

In addition to Prof. Kathuria, the panel will feature Mr. Ranil Pathirana – Managing Director, Hirdaramani Group, Mr. Chathura Abeyratne – Director/COO, Joint Agri Products Ceylon, Dr. Upendra Peiris – Chief Executive Officer, OREL IT, and Dr. T. Sayandhan – CEO, Sunshine Healthcare, with Ms. Subhashini Abeysinghe – Research Director, Verité Research, moderating the discussion.
